“Spyro – Who Is Your Guy?” is an Afrobeats song by Nigerian artist Spyro (real name Oludipe Oluwasanmi David) that became a major viral hit and social‑media anthem from 2023 onward.
What “Who Is Your Guy?” Means
In the song, “guy” doesn’t mean a boyfriend or girlfriend in the literal sense; it’s street slang for:
- Your closest friend or ride-or-die
- Someone you can rely on through stress and success
- A person you publicly “claim” as part of your inner circle
The hook literally asks, “Who is your guy? (Spyro), na only me walahi,” which is Spyro saying: “Who’s really in your corner? For you, that person should be me alone, I’m fully loyal.”
Theme and Message
The lyrics revolve around loyalty, gratitude, and solid friendships:
- “I will never leave your side” and “I dedicate my time to you my guy” underline unwavering support.
- Lines like “See as we dey like beans and rice” use everyday imagery to show a natural, inseparable pairing.
- There’s a rejection of “bad energy” and appreciation for “real gees” (true friends), making it an ode to genuine relationships, not fake clout connections.
So when people say “Spyro who is your guy?” online, they’re usually referencing:
- The song itself, or
- Playfully asking: “Who’s that one person you really trust the way Spyro describes?”
Who Spyro Is
- Full name: Oludipe Oluwasanmi David.
- Profession: Nigerian singer and songwriter known for Afrobeats and Afro‑fusion.
- Breakout: “Who Is Your Guy?” pushed him into mainstream and social‑media fame, with the track trending on TikTok, Instagram, and Nigerian music platforms.
